ETH Zürich invites applications for a Postdoc in Resilient Satellite Navigation (GNSS) within the Chair of Space Geodesy, led by Prof. Benedikt Soja. This position is ideal for researchers passionate about advancing navigation resilience and tackling signal interference challenges. The team is recognized for innovative methods in space- and ground-based geodetic and navigation applications, focusing on high-precision, continuous, and real-time positioning. Their work leverages machine learning for Positioning, Navigation, and Timing (PNT) and geomonitoring, including signal characterization and anomaly detection.
The successful candidate will lead GNSS-based research and support ongoing projects related to GNSS and PNT. Responsibilities include developing GNSS software using Factor Graph Optimization, implementing multi-sensor fusion strategies, advancing real-time GNSS processing for jamming and spoofing mitigation, integrating AI/ML concepts, and working with GNSS equipment and simulators. Academic leadership is expected through high-impact publications and grant applications, as well as teaching and supervision of PhD and Master students.
Applicants must have a PhD in Geodesy, Geomatics, Aerospace Engineering, Signal Processing, or a related field, with proven GNSS data analysis and processing experience. Strong programming skills (Python, C++) and fluency in English are required. Experience with Factor Graph Optimization, sensor fusion, or AI/ML is advantageous. CH/EU/EFTA citizenship or a valid Swiss work permit and proficiency in German are beneficial. The team values analytical, self-motivated, and interdisciplinary candidates.
ETH Zürich offers unique access to GNSS networks, independent research opportunities, a dynamic international team, and a supportive environment. Benefits include salary according to ETH standards, flexible working hours, part-time home office, and an attractive workplace. The position is full-time (100%) Postdoc or, for advanced candidates, as an Established Researcher (Oberassistent), with an initial contract of 2 years and possible extension. The ideal start date is 1 July 2026 or earlier.
